It's playoff time, and Wylie East had no trouble coming through when it counted. Their pitcher stepped up to hand the Royse City Bulldogs a 4-0 shutout on Saturday. This was a revenge game for the Raiders: when they faced off against the Bulldogs on Friday, they had to take a 8-3 defeat.

The result came thanks to Kimma Kincaid's shutout, as she gave up just three hits and racked up seven Ks. She has been nothing but reliable on the mound: she hasn't given up more than two walks in five consecutive appearances.
On the hitting side, Isabella Flores was excellent, going 1-for-3 with one home run and two RBI. The team also got some help courtesy of Kyra Tawney, who went 1-for-3 with two RBI and one double.
Wylie East is on a roll lately: they've won 14 of their last 17 matches. That's provided a nice bump to their 21-10-1 record this season. Those victories came thanks in part to their hitting performance across that stretch, as they averaged 12.3 runs over those games. As for Royse City, they moved to 22-8 with that loss, which also ended their three-game winning streak.
Wylie East will have a chance to go back-to-back against the Bulldogs: the pair will be back at it again later today.
